Yaesu ATAS-25 manually-tuned portable antenna HF for (FT-847, FT-857. FT-897, FT-817, FT-450, FTDX-10, FT-710) 7, 14, 21, 28, 50, 144 AND 430 MHz. The ATAS-25 is a manually-tuned portable antenna system ideal for the FT-817, FT-897, and FT-857 transceivers. Capable of operating on the Amateur bands between 7 MHz and 450 MHz, the ATAS-25 is designed for mounting on a standard 1/4" camera tripod stud (tripod not supplied), and includes an innovative fine-tuning system allowing precise SWR adjustment in the field.

Yaesu ATAS-120 A automatic antenna for Yaesu FT-450, FT-897, FT-857, FT-991, FT-891, FTDX-10, FT-710 amateur radios. 7, 14, 21, 28, 50, 144 and 430 MHz. The Yaesu ATAS-120 Active Tuning Antenna System provides HF/VHF/UHF coverage with automatic motorized tuning. Utilizing control signals from the transceivers microprocessor received via the coaxial cable, the ATAS-120's internal motor adjusts the radiator length for best SWR.
